Kgf/cm2 to atm Conversion Formula:
One Kg-force per square cm is equal to 0.967841105354 Standard Atmosphere.
Formula: 1 kgf/cm2 = 0.967841105354 atm
By using this conversion factor, you can easily convert any pressure from kg-force per square cm to standard atmosphere with precision.
How to Convert kgf/cm2 to atm?
Converting from kgf/cm2 to atm is a straightforward process. Follow these steps to ensure accurate conversions from kg-force per square cm to standard atmosphere:
- Select the Kg-force per square cm Value: Start by determining the kg-force per square cm (kgf/cm2) value you want to convert into standard atmosphere (atm). This is your starting point.
- Multiply by the Conversion Factor: To convert kg-force per square cm to standard atmosphere, multiply the selected kgf/cm2 value by 0.967841105354. This factor is essential for accurately converting from a smaller unit (kgf/cm2) to a much larger unit (atm).
- Illustration of Multiplication:
- 1 kgf/cm2 = 0.967841105354 atm
- 10 kgf/cm2 = 9.678411054 atm
- 100 kgf/cm2 = 96.784110535 atm
- Find the Conversion Result: The result of this multiplication is your converted value in standard atmosphere unit. This represents the same pressure but in a different unit.
- Save Your Standard Atmosphere Value: After converting, remember to save the result. This value represents the pressure you initially measured, now expressed in standard atmospheres.
- Alternative Method – Division: If you prefer not to multiply, you can achieve the same conversion by dividing the kg-force per square cm value by 1.033227453. This alternative method also gives you the correct pressure in standard atmospheres.
- Illustration of Division:
- atm = kgf/cm2 ÷ 1.033227453
